Fort Wayne flood warning canceled

Photo of flooding at Foster Park

The National Weather Service has canceled its flood warning for the St. Mary’s River at Muldoon Bridge (South Anthony Blvd. Extended), including areas along the river in Fort Wayne. At 9 a.m. today, the river level at the Muldoon Bridge gauge was 13.9 feet (0.1 feet below flood stage) and falling.

At 8:33 a.m. this morning, the Allen County Highway Department reported that two roads remained closed due to high water:

  • South County Line Road between U.S. 27 and Winchester Road.
  • Marion Center Road between U.S. 27 and Winchester Road.
